FIFA’s $20 billion privatization plan faces revolt from UEFA and Concacaf, raising questions about sports finance

Share

FIFA President Gianni Infantino wants to create a $20 billion subsidiary called FIFA Forward Enterprise and sell 20-21% equity to private investors for approximately $4.2 billion, while retaining majority ownership. UEFA, Concacaf, and the Asian Football Confederation have all opposed the plan, with UEFA calling it « non-negotiable » and hinting at possible boycotts of future FIFA events. National associations have until September 19, 2026 to approve the deal, with a $20 million sweetener offered for early signers. If successful, the $20 billion valuation would make it one of the largest sports-related private transactions ever attempted.
